探索华为光猫配置解析:开源工具高效应用实用指南
当你需要深入了解光猫设备配置细节时,一款可靠的配置解析工具就成为技术探索的关键。华为光猫配置解析工具作为开源项目,为网络技术爱好者和管理员提供了高效解密设备配置文件的解决方案。本文将从核心价值出发,通过实际应用场景解析,带你掌握这款工具的全面使用方法,轻松应对各类配置解析需求。
核心价值:为什么选择这款开源工具
目标:突破配置读取限制 | 方法:多格式解密支持
该工具最核心的价值在于打破了华为光猫配置文件的加密壁垒,支持XML和CFG两种主流格式文件的解密操作。不同于商业软件的功能限制,这款开源工具完全免费且源代码透明,让你可以自由探索设备配置的每一个细节。
目标:跨平台灵活使用 | 方法:QT框架优势
基于QT框架开发的特性,使工具能够在Windows、Linux等多种操作系统上稳定运行。无论你是在桌面环境还是服务器端工作,都能获得一致的操作体验,这对于需要在不同平台间迁移工作的技术人员尤为重要。
目标:简化专业操作 | 方法:直观图形界面
工具采用直观的图形界面设计,将复杂的解密算法封装为简单的按钮操作。即使你不具备深入的密码学知识,也能通过"选择文件-点击解密"的简单流程完成专业级配置解析,大大降低了技术门槛。
场景应用:配置解析工具的实际用武之地
场景一:网络故障排查
当光猫出现连接不稳定、带宽异常等问题时,解密配置文件能帮助你分析关键参数。通过查看解密后的网络配置详情,可快速定位如端口映射错误、VLAN设置冲突等常见问题根源。
场景二:定制化配置优化
不同网络环境对光猫参数有特定要求。解密配置文件后,你可以根据实际需求调整DNS服务器、QoS带宽限制等高级设置,实现网络性能的精准优化,这在企业网络管理中尤为实用。
场景三:设备迁移与克隆
更换新光猫时,解密旧设备配置文件可实现快速参数迁移。通过对比分析新旧配置差异,确保服务无缝切换,避免重复配置带来的时间成本和错误风险。
实施指南:从准备到验证的完整流程
准备阶段:环境搭建与工具获取
目标:获取工具源码 | 方法:Git仓库克隆
git clone https://gitcode.com/gh_mirrors/hu/HuaWei-Optical-Network-Terminal-Decoder
目标:配置开发环境 | 方法:依赖安装
确保系统已安装Qt Creator开发环境(推荐5.x版本)、zlib数据压缩库和C++编译工具链。这些组件是工具编译和运行的基础,缺少任何一项都可能导致功能异常。
目标:项目配置检查 | 方法:pro文件验证
打开根目录下的hua.pro文件,确认zlib库路径配置正确。这一步是保证编译成功的关键,错误的路径设置会直接导致解密功能无法正常工作。
执行阶段:解密操作实战
目标:解密XML文件 | 方法:图形界面操作
启动工具后,在"XML加解密"区域点击文件选择按钮,导入目标XML配置文件,然后点击"解密"按钮。工具会自动处理文件并显示解密结果,整个过程通常在几秒内完成。
目标:解密CFG文件 | 方法:图形界面操作
在"CFG加解密"区域执行类似操作,选择CFG格式文件并点击解密。该功能专门针对华为光猫导出的标准配置文件设计,能完美处理这类文件的加密格式。
目标:解密密文内容 | 方法:三种解密方式选择
对于单独的密文片段,可在"密文解密"区域输入内容,根据加密类型选择"$1解密"、"$2解密"或"SU解密"方式。这三种算法覆盖了华为光猫常用的加密方案,确保各类密文都能有效解析。
验证阶段:结果确认与应用
目标:验证解密有效性 | 方法:内容检查
解密完成后,首先检查结果是否包含清晰的配置参数,如IP地址、端口设置等。正常解密的文件应该呈现结构化的文本内容,而非乱码或不完整信息。
目标:确保配置可用性 | 方法:参数对比
将解密后的配置与设备当前运行参数进行对比,确认关键配置项一致。特别注意网络相关参数,如网关地址、DNS设置等,这些直接影响设备联网功能。
目标:安全保存结果 | 方法:文件备份
将解密后的配置文件保存到安全位置,并做好版本标记。建议使用"设备型号-日期"的命名方式,便于后续查找和对比分析。
进阶技巧:提升配置解析效率的实用方法
目标:批量处理配置文件 | 方法:文件分类策略
当需要处理多个配置文件时,建议按文件类型(XML/CFG)和设备型号分类存放。这种组织方式能显著提高操作效率,避免在大量文件中查找目标的时间浪费。
目标:深入理解配置参数 | 方法:关键项注释
在解密后的文件中,对关键配置项添加注释说明。例如记录特定参数的作用、正常取值范围等信息,这不仅便于自己后续查阅,也能帮助团队协作中的知识共享。
目标:自动化解析流程 | 方法:脚本辅助
对于需要频繁执行的解密操作,可以编写简单脚本调用工具命令行接口(如有)。虽然工具主要提供图形界面,但通过分析源码可能发现隐藏的命令行功能,实现半自动化处理。
常见误区:澄清配置解析的认知偏差
误区一:解密配置会导致设备损坏?
不会。配置解析只是读取和展示设备的配置信息,不会对设备本身进行任何写入操作。只要不修改并重新导入配置,就不会影响设备正常运行。
误区二:所有华为光猫配置都能解密?
并非绝对。不同型号、不同固件版本的光猫可能采用不同加密方案。工具支持大多数常见型号,但遇到特殊加密方式时可能需要等待更新或尝试其他解密算法。
误区三:解密后的配置可以直接用于其他设备?
需谨慎。不同设备的硬件参数存在差异,直接导入可能导致功能异常。建议仅参考配置思路,而非完全复制所有参数,特别是涉及硬件地址、端口映射等设备特定的设置。
功能演示:工具操作全流程
图1:华为光猫配置解析工具主界面,包含三大功能模块,支持多种格式的配置解析操作
探索任务:实践中提升配置解析能力
- 尝试解密不同型号华为光猫的配置文件,比较它们在参数设置上的异同点
- 分析解密后的配置文件,识别并记录至少5个影响网络性能的关键参数
- 模拟网络故障场景,通过配置解析定位可能的问题根源
- 尝试将解密后的配置文件转换为可视化表格,提升参数分析效率
通过这些实践任务,你不仅能熟练掌握工具的使用技巧,还能深化对光猫配置原理的理解,为网络管理和优化工作打下坚实基础。记住,技术探索永无止境,每一次配置解析都是深入了解网络设备的机会。
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
HY-Embodied-0.5这是一套专为现实世界具身智能打造的基础模型。该系列模型采用创新的混合Transformer(Mixture-of-Transformers, MoT) 架构,通过潜在令牌实现模态特异性计算,显著提升了细粒度感知能力。Jinja00
LongCat-AudioDiT-1BLongCat-AudioDiT 是一款基于扩散模型的文本转语音(TTS)模型,代表了当前该领域的最高水平(SOTA),它直接在波形潜空间中进行操作。00
ERNIE-ImageERNIE-Image 是由百度 ERNIE-Image 团队开发的开源文本到图像生成模型。它基于单流扩散 Transformer(DiT)构建,并配备了轻量级的提示增强器,可将用户的简短输入扩展为更丰富的结构化描述。凭借仅 80 亿的 DiT 参数,它在开源文本到图像模型中达到了最先进的性能。该模型的设计不仅追求强大的视觉质量,还注重实际生成场景中的可控性,在这些场景中,准确的内容呈现与美观同等重要。特别是,ERNIE-Image 在复杂指令遵循、文本渲染和结构化图像生成方面表现出色,使其非常适合商业海报、漫画、多格布局以及其他需要兼具视觉质量和精确控制的内容创作任务。它还支持广泛的视觉风格,包括写实摄影、设计导向图像以及更多风格化的美学输出。Jinja00